Wonderful location on the fountain level of The Bellagio. We took advantage of the concierge at our hotel to make our reservations. Their patio has an awesome view of the fountain show. We had a late seating (around 9pm) but we never felt rushed and our service was top notch. We started with the bacon wrapped shrimp and a cup of the onion soup. Both of which were good choices. My filet was a little over cooked for my liking, our server noticed it and before I could stop her she quickly took my plate and brought me a new one. (cooked perfectly) We had a great meal finished with a huge piece of cheesecake.

Prime is an amazing dining experience for special occasions, or for regular high-end dining. Definitely try to get a patio seat as the fountain makes the experience so much better.Service is very attentive. Food and utensils are delivered and remove efficiently, without making you feel rushed.Plan for a comfortable 90 minutes or more for dining. The steaks and sides are all as delicious as you'd expect.
